		<description><![CDATA[The Robotics Industry Association reports that sales of industrial robot units declined by 30% in 2006.  The revenue from robot sales fell 22%
The decline was due to the falloff in robot sales to automotive manufacturers. 2005 was a particularly good year for sales to the auto industry so demand was expected to slump.

		<description><![CDATA[Microsoft released their Robotics Studio Software yesterday.  The robotics software, which was announced back in June, is a complete development environment for robots.  It includes a visual programming language, a 3-D virtual simulation environment and a runtime framework for interfacing with all kinds of hardware.

		<description><![CDATA[According to statistics released by Robotic Industries Association (RIA), the robot trade group, new orders received by North American based robotics companies fell 38% in the first half of 2006.
